Firefighter injured after early morning fire

FORT WAYNE, Ind. (WOWO) – The Fort Wayne Fire Department responded to a fire alarm at the 900 block of Woodland Plaza around 4:38 a.m. on Sunday morning.

Upon arrival, firefighters found a fire on a counter inside of a business that had extended to the attic area. A firefighter was injured while working inside the structure.

Firefighters had the fire under control in just over an hour. The building suffered moderate damage.  Nobody was in the building at the time of the fire.  The fire remains under investigation.
